We shared our landing page in a few Facebook groups to test our startup idea and gain feedbacks. In the next days we ended up on Product Hunt, Fast Company and Gizmodo. We weren't ready for it and ... we'd like to share with you what we learned during the unplanned launch of Earlyclaim.com

15. TAKEAWAYS
Product Hunt: best to reach “startup people” and investors: great buzz seed. We
assume high bounce was due to lack of information about our startup
Fast Company: best performer on social medias: it got shared. A lot. Lowest bounce
Gizmodo largest traffic generator and geographical reach. Instrumental in getting the
word out to Asian / Oceanic countries and start buzz there.
EXTRA POINTS
Hacker News (surfaced on August 10th) only generated 124 unique visitors. Lack of
information about our startup was a real, huge problem for this source.
Twitter was a crucial distribution channel, driving momentum/buzz/coverage.
